    I have been trying my best to get this post indexed on google:
    https://www.pyrodes.com/2008/10/22/pyrodes-top-5-chinatown-buses-ny-dc-edition/

    The posts I wrote prior to it are indexed, and the ones I write after it are promptly indexed. I took it down and republished it. I created a sitemap of my site and submitted it to google successfully. I have pinged google in every way imaginable. There is nothing fancy on the post that should confuse the robot.

    What gives? Any suggestions?

Viewing 2 replies - 1 through 2 (of 2 total)
  • You are having duplicate content issues. Google has the content of the post indexed for the home page and for a category page. The single post page probably won’t show up in the index until new posts push it off of the front page.

    Also, you need more quality incoming links (increased pagerank and authority) to help increase your percentage of indexed pages. Google will not index every page from a new, low or no pagerank site.
